Pump Shaft Grinding Applications Using NC Cylindrical Grinding Machine
The EMTU Plus Series NC Cylindrical Grinding Machine is widely used for external diameter grinding of submersible pump shafts. The machine includes an inbuilt NC system and supports auto, semi-auto, and manual grinding cycles.
Moreover, the machine offers auto dressing compensation for consistent size control during production. Therefore, it is highly suitable for repetitive grinding applications in pump manufacturing industries.
Additionally, operators can easily use the machine because the NC system works with simple numeric data entry. As a result, no skilled CNC programmer is required for operation. Moreover, the machine supports automatic grinding cycles for stable mass production.

The EMTU Plus Series NC Cylindrical Grinding Machine delivers high-precision pump shaft grinding with easy HMI-based operation. Additionally, the machine supports plunge and oscillation grinding cycles with automatic grinding compensation for repetitive production.
The machine is ideal for:
- Pump shaft OD grinding (up to 6 Dia. in single setting)
- Straight diameter grinding
- Repetitive production jobs
- Oscillation and Plunge grinding cycle

Thrust Pad Grinding Application for Submersible Pump Components

The i GRIND 200 machine performs thrust pad face grinding using a special cup wheel mounted face grinding spindle. Therefore, it achieves high flatness and improved surface quality required for submersible pump applications.

NC vs CNC Grinding Machine Comparison for Pump and Motor Grinding Applications
Both NC and CNC grinding machines are widely used in pump shaft, bush, and motor rotor grinding applications. NC grinding machines offer easy operation with simple numeric data input and flexible plunge or oscillation cycle selection through HMI touch panel. On the other hand, CNC grinding machines provide advanced automation, profile grinding capability, and program-based operation for complex applications.
